Upcoming Server Downtimes:

Solclaim Hardware Upgrade, Monday, June 9th, 9am PT
Over the past several weeks, many of you have participated in helping us test the ShadowClaim test world, where we were trying out new hardware for Asheron’s Call. Those tests went very well (thank you, to all who participated!), so we’re ready to take the next step.

On Monday, June 9th at 9:00am PT (Noon ET) we will be taking Solclaim down and moving this world to new and improved hardware. Our goal in this process is to extend the life and improve the performance of the AC1 worlds for several years to come and this is another step in that process. Our testing efforts on Shadowclaim have been met with a great deal of success and we are ready to take the next step in our hardware migration plans.

When we take the servers down on Monday morning, we will be backing up the existing Solclaim database along with the character information and data from the world. Once the world is back online, you'll find that you can pick up right where you left off before the world went offline. All your character information and data will be right as it was before. Hopefully, you will also notice improved sever performance once we complete this important transition.

We will be watching the progress of the new Solclaim hardware very closely and have extensive backup plans in place in the event we see any kind of negative performance from the new hardware systems. In the event something doesn't go right with the new hardware rollout, we have a plan in place to move Solclaim back to it's original hardware and there should be nary a hiccup in the process. Some of you may be asking "Is there anything bad that can happen to my character or my gear if we have to go back to the old hardware?" The answer is still "no" because the hardware swap doesn't affect the character database.

We're looking forward to Monday and the opportunity to improve the performance of the other AC1 worlds in the months ahead and for years to come.
